In this high-visibility role, you will be the main architect of our efforts to achieve operational efficiency, drive sustainable growth, and establish a culture of excellence. You will lead, mentor, and empower cross-functional teams and stakeholders, identifying and championing strategic initiatives, implementing transformative solutions, and embedding a culture of continuous improvement throughout Supply Chain Management (SCM).
You will report directly to the Head of Change Management, Continuous Improvement, and SCM External Regulations (CMCI) based in Zurich, Switzerland. As a key member of our international SCM CMCI Team, you will collaborate with senior colleagues and leadership across various Business Units, countries, and regions to instill a culture of elite performance and strategic agility.
How You'll Make An Impact
- Leadership and Strategic Vision:
- Define and execute a multi-year SCM continuous improvement strategy aligned with the function's strategic and digitalization objectives.
- Foster a culture of operational excellence, driving sustained improvement and establishing global best practices.
- Develop and deploy advanced CI frameworks, methodologies, and tools across SCM.
- Lean & Advanced Analytics Expertise:
- Lead enterprise-level Value Stream Mapping initiatives to optimize processes, eliminate waste, reduce costs, and allocate resources strategically.
- Implement Lean methodologies to improve efficiency, quality, and responsiveness.
- Identify and integrate AI and machine learning use cases to enhance productivity and decision-making.
- Program and Performance Management:
- Oversee the end-to-end Lean/Continuous Improvement transformation across SCM, ensuring timely delivery and adherence to budgets.
- Establish a framework for monitoring and reporting on CI metrics, KPIs, and ROI.
- Manage a portfolio of high-impact CI programs, aligning them with business objectives.
- Capability Building and Organizational Change Leadership:
- Design and deliver advanced training programs on Lean principles and tools.
- Drive large-scale organizational change management initiatives, promoting a Lean culture.
- Mentor and develop future CI leaders within the organization.
- Responsible for ensuring compliance with applicable external and internal regulations, procedures, and guidelines.
- Living Hitachi Energy's core values safety and integrity, which means taking responsibility for your own actions while caring for your colleagues and the business.
Your Background
- Bachelor's degree required; advanced degree (Master's or Ph.D.) in Science, Engineering, Business, Supply Chain Management, Data Science, or a related field preferred.
- Minimum 10+ years of relevant work experience, with a significant portion dedicated to leading large-scale process development and continuous improvement programs.
- Certifications:
- Black Belt (BB) certification required.
- Preferred certifications include Project Management Professional (PMP) and advanced Change Management certifications (e.g., PROSCI).
- Proven track record of delivering measurable business results through CI initiatives.
- Expert knowledge of Lean methodologies and tools.
- Experience with process mining and mapping processes.
- Experience with Digital & AI technologies, machine learning, and advanced data analytics platforms.
- Experience with data analysis and interpretation to measure impact and ROI.
- Strong strategic planning, execution, and monitoring capabilities.
- Ability to influence senior leadership and secure buy-in for large-scale organizational change.
- Excellent communication and presentation skills.
- Experience in training and mentoring teams on CI principles.
- Ability to lead in complex global environments.
- Proficiency in both spoken & written English language is required.
